Installation
This custom-fit T-connector plugs into your vehicle's wiring harness, which is located behind the driver's-side and passenger's-side tail lights. You will have to remove the trunk floor coverings, storage trays, rear scuff panel, and the tail light assemblies to access this harness. Once you've plugged in the T-connector, run the hot lead up to your car battery. Connect the lead to the included fuse holder, and then connect the fuse holder to the positive terminal on your battery.
Once installation is complete, the 4-way connector will be stowed in an out-of-the-way location within your trunk.
It is recommended that you use a small amount of grease on all electrical connections - the plugs on your automobile and the 4-pole connector itself - to help prevent corrosion.
A tail light converter is built into this T-connector. This converter is a circuit-protected, battery-powered unit that bypasses the electrical routes that are used by a basic wiring harness. As a result, there is virtually no draw on your tail light circuits.
Because most trailers run on a two-wire system - wherein the brake and turn signals are carried on one wire - the separate brake and turn signals from your vehicle's three-wire system need to be combined so they are compatible with the wiring system of the trailer. This converter combines the brake and turn signal functions of your automobile so that they run on one wire to properly activate your trailer's tail lights. Note: This will not affect how the tail lights on your vehicle operate.
Curt builds each tail light converter using surface-mount technology (SMT). This method of construction involves soldering electronic components directly to the surface of a printed circuit board. SMT eliminates the need for leads, which are used in older through-hole technology. The result is a circuit board that is smaller yet provides more routing area and that offers superior performance, reliability and durability.
Circuit boards constructed using SMT have been shown to perform better under rough conditions with excessive vibration than those made using the through-hole method. And where would vibration be more likely to occur than in towing applications? Curt converters also produce less heat, leading to increased durability and longer life. In addition, lower levels of resistance ensure better performance, especially for parts that operate at higher frequencies.

First I would like to commend etrailer on their customer service. I received this wiring harness for my 2016 Subaru Impreza 5-Door Sport Limited. Installation wasn't too bad except that the plugs are WAY too big to fit through the existing grommets for the taillight assemblies. They say "make a small cut," but really you need to just cut a wide circle. If you cut too long of a slit, you risk cutting through the end. So just cut a wide circle. Look at my pictures for size of the grey plugs compared to the grommet.
I wired everything up, and headed out 750 miles to buy a trailer over a weekend. When I connected to the trailer the brake lights and turn signals worked, but the tail lights did not. I drove the 750 miles home anyway, just not at night. I did some trouble shooting with a voltmeter and saw that the brown wire in the connection didn't have any power. I emailed etrailer and they sent me a new one.
A few days later the new one arrived and, after having to uninstall the old and reinstall the new harness, it also didn't work. Instead of using the voltmeter I went and bought an inexpensive 12 volt light bulb tester. I was able to verify that my hot wire from the battery and the ground were working. The brown wire, which feeds the tail lights, was not. I checked the brown wire before the black box in the harness and it also wasn't getting power there. So I followed the brown wire back to the driver's side plugs on the harness.
The vehicle plug has six spots, but only 5 have wires coming in. You can see it in the pictures. The Curt harness has six wires. The brown wire was connected to the spot where there was no vehicle wire. That's why it wasn't getting any power. I called Curt Customer service and they had no explanation. They verified my VIN and that this harness should work for my vehicle; they have had no other calls regarding this harness, but they also don't know how many other people have tried my specific year. They think there is a possibility this will only effect some individual cars or perhaps my entire model year. But apparently my car has a different rear light assembly than they think it is supposed to have.
I was able to cut and splice the appropriate wires with solder and heat shrink. I now have a working harness, but I should not have had to go through these lengths for a harness that was supposedly built for my vehicle. If you want a harness for your Impreza I would recommend you give one of the other brands a try and not this Curt model.
I installed the wiring harness in a 2013 Subaru Impreza 5-door. The biggest challenge was running the power supply wire to the battery. Here's what I did.
I removed the rear seats (check online videos for details) and the threshold trim from the driver's side (both driver and passenger trim). I then ran the wire through the door jam up to the fuse box (lower left of steering wheel). I then used a fuse tap to extend an extra circuit from the unused 20 amp trailer circuit. The fuse tap allows you to install a separate fuse for the extension - I picked 10 amps (of course). The circuit is NOT switched - it's on even when the key is out. So I disconnected the tap while connecting the power wire to the wiring harness. Works like a charm and looks good (invisible).
It took a lot longer to figure out how I was going to hook the power wire up (lots of googling) than to actually do it. For other automobiles, I recommend checking for audio amp installation guides - they have similar issues.

Wiring kit came just as advertised , plug and play. Installation was easy, only time consuming part was running the power wire to the battery underneath all the plastic car panels. Everything seemed to work until I noticed my passenger side back up light was constantly on whenever I turned my lights on. And as I expected after, would turn off when I put the car in reverse. After taking the taillight out and a quick inspection I saw that the adapter plugs had 2 wires, the running light signal and the reverse light signal, connected to the wrong pin locations. Slightly disappointed, but a quick cut and resplice of the 2 wires made a quick correction. Hope they fix this in the future. Overall still good product worth the buy.
